On the afternoon of May 17, Mr. Nguyen Long (residing in Vinh Hai ward, Nha Trang city) said he stepped on many lumps of oil on the beach near Tram Huong tower area and smelled the burning smell of oil.
Over the past two days, many residents and tourists swimming in Nha Trang beach have expressed their discomfort with clumps of oil sticking to their bodies and clothes, making it difficult to wash off.

According to Mr. Dam Hai Van, Head of Nha Trang Bay Management Board, the situation of oil clumping from offshore due to waves has been happening for many years. The oil clumps mixed with sand are very difficult to distinguish and are collected and cleaned by environmental staff. Currently, related departments are still investigating the cause. The Board has also reported to Nha Trang City People's Committee for further handling.

Last year, oil clumps also appeared on Nha Trang beach, many people were worried and did not dare to swim.
According to experts, the black clumps mentioned above are likely a mixture of many substances discharged into the sea by ocean-going ships. Over time, they settle on the seabed, change their chemical properties into black clumps of oil, and then follow the currents to wash ashore.
